Motorola Razr 2024 eSIM FAQ

Yes, the Motorola Razr 2024 fully supports eSIM technology. This allows you to digitally store your cellular plan without needing a physical SIM card.

Yes, the Motorola Razr 2024 supports dual SIM functionality. You can typically achieve this by using one physical nano-SIM card and one eSIM, or sometimes by using two eSIMs depending on your carrier's support. This is ideal for separating personal and work lines or for international travel.

Activating an eSIM on your Motorola Razr 2024 is a straightforward process. You will usually receive a QR code from your carrier which you can scan directly from your phone's settings.

  • Go to Settings.
  • Tap Network & internet.
  • Select SIMs or Mobile network.
  • Choose Download a SIM or Add an eSIM.
  • Scan the QR code provided by your carrier and follow the on-screen prompts to complete the activation.

Using an eSIM on your Motorola Razr 2024 offers several advantages. It allows for easier switching between cellular plans, particularly when traveling internationally, as you won't need to swap physical cards. Additionally, it frees up the physical SIM card slot for another SIM if you need dual SIM capabilities, and can also enhance security as an eSIM cannot be physically removed from the device.

No, the Motorola Razr 2024, if purchased unlocked, is not locked to a specific carrier for eSIM usage. You can use an eSIM from any supported carrier with your device. If you purchased your phone through a specific carrier, it might be carrier-locked, which would restrict your eSIM options until unlocked.
